Book Details


Table of Contents

An allegorical description of a certain island and its inhabitants.
Sequel to the vision of Bangor in the twentieth century, by J. S. Appleton.
The milltillionaire, 1895, by M. Auburré-Hovorré.
To whom this may come, by E. Bellamy.
Dream of a free-trade paradise, by C. Elder.
Three hundred years hence, by M. Griffith.
A vision of Bangor in the twentieth century, by E. Kent.
The Midas plague, by F. Pohl.
Equality
a political romance, by J. Reynolds.
The coup d'état of 1961, by H. D. Sedgwick.
The curious republic of Gondour, by M. Twain.
